The M42 motorway runs north east from Bromsgrove in Worcestershire to just south west of Ashby-de-la-Zouch in Leicestershire, passing Redditch, Solihull, the National Exhibition Centre (NEC) and Tamworth on the way, serving the east of the Birmingham metropolitan area. The motorway between London and Oxford was constructed in stages between 1967 and 1974. The first section opened in June 1967, from Handy Cross roundabout, High Wycombe to Stokenchurch (junctions 4–5). The first motorway in Ireland to be fully completed end to end, the M1 is highly strategically important as it links Dublin with Belfast via the Northern Ireland road network. It was built between 1985 and 2007. The N1 route begins in O'Connell St in the very centre of Dublin. It uses the street network to make ...
